9 # GENERIC machine description file
10 #
11 # This machine description file is used to generate the default NetBSD
12 # kernel. The generic kernel does not include all options, subsystems
13 # and device drivers, but should be useful for most applications.
14 #
15 # The machine description file can be customised for your specific
16 # machine to reduce the kernel size and improve its performance.
17 #
18 # For further information on compiling NetBSD kernels, see the config(8)
19 # man page.
20 #
21 # For further information on hardware support for this architecture, see
22 # the intro(4) man page. For further information about kernel options
23 # for this architecture, see the options(4) man page. For an explanation
24 # of each device driver in this file see the section 4 man page for the
25 # device.

201 # Amiga specific options
202 #
203 #options LIMITMEM=24 # Do not use more than LIMITMEM MB of the
204 # first bank of RAM. (default: unlimited)
205 #options NKPTADD=4 # set this for 4 additional KPT pages
206 #options NKPTADDSHIFT=24 # set this for 1 additional KPT page
207 # per 16 MB (1<<24 bytes) of RAM
208 # uncomment and decrease this, or uncomment and
209 # increase NKPTADD if you get "out of PT pages"
210 # panics.
